Blood is a specialized fluid that constantly flows throughout your body
It’s made of plasma, red blood cells, white blood cells and platelets. Blood is a fluid that transports oxygen and nutrients to cells and carries away carbon dioxide and other waste products It contains specialized cells that serve particular functions These cells are suspended in a liquid matrix known as plasma.

It has four main components Plasma, red blood cells, white blood cells, and platelets The blood that runs through the veins, arteries, and capillaries is known as whole blood—a mixture of about 55% plasma and 45% blood cells
About 7% to 8% of your total body weight is blood.
